Ingredients :

  • Extra virgin olive oil — The one ingredient where saving money directly affects the taste. A good oil has slight bitterness and a peppery finish—two qualities that hold up well to gentle heat.
  • Fresh garlic — Crushed with the flat of the knife, not chopped. Crushed garlic releases its oils gradually into the heat, staying mild. Finely chopped, it burns in seconds and becomes unpleasantly bitter.
  • Aromatic herbs — Dried rosemary and oregano as a base—they withstand heat without degrading. For fresh herbs like basil, reserve them for serving, never during cooking.
  • Red chili flakes — A modest amount is enough—just a slight heat that hits the back of the throat a few seconds after swallowing. The goal is to balance the richness of the oil, not to burn.
